这里是文章模块栏目内容页
redis主从和持久化(redis主从架构高可用如何实现)

导读:Redis作为一种高性能的key-value存储系统,具有快速、可靠、灵活等优点。本文将从主从复制和持久化两个方面介绍Redis的基础知识,帮助读者更好地理解Redis的使用。

1. 主从复制

主从复制是指在Redis中,一个节点(称为主节点)可以将数据同步到其他节点(称为从节点)。主节点负责写入操作,而从节点则负责读取操作。主从复制可以提高Redis的性能和可用性。

2. 持久化

Redis支持两种持久化方式:RDB和AOF。RDB持久化是将Redis中的数据保存到磁盘上,以便在服务器重启时恢复数据。AOF持久化则是将Redis执行的所有写操作记录到一个文件中,以便在服务器重启时重新执行这些操作。

3. RDB持久化

RDB持久化是通过创建一个快照来实现的。当用户设置了RDB持久化后,Redis会定期将内存中的数据快照写入到磁盘上。用户可以通过配置文件来设置快照的触发时间。

4. AOF持久化

AOF持久化是通过记录Redis执行的所有写操作来实现的。当用户设置了AOF持久化后,Redis会将每个写操作记录到一个文件中。当Redis重启时,它会重新执行这些写操作以恢复数据。

总结:本文介绍了Redis中的主从复制和持久化两个方面。主从复制可以提高Redis的性能和可用性,而持久化则可以保证Redis在服务器重启时不会丢失数据。通过学习本文,读者可以更好地了解Redis的基础知识,为其后续使用打下坚实的基础。